XmlSerializerFormatAttribute.SupportFaults Свойство
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Возвращает или задает значение, указывающее, должен ли для чтения и записи сбоев использоваться сериализатор XmlSerializer.
public:
property bool SupportFaults { bool get(); void set(bool value); };
public bool SupportFaults { get; set; }
member this.SupportFaults : bool with get, set
Public Property SupportFaults As Boolean
Значение свойства
true
, если для чтения и записи сбоев должен использоваться сериализатор XmlSerializer; false
, если должен использоваться сериализатор DataContractSerializer. Значение по умолчанию — false
.
Комментарии
Модуль форматирования по умолчанию для сериализации сбоев — DataContractSerializer. Чтобы использовать XmlSerializer, задайте для этого свойства значение true
. Начиная с версии .NET 4, сериализатор, заданный в свойстве SupportFaults, будет использоваться даже в случае, когда для контракта, к которому применяется атрибут XmlSerializerFormatAttribute, задано пользовательское поведение.